
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) at K.K.C. College of Education Overview
The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) offered by K.K.C. College of Education is known for its industry-oriented curriculum and syllabus. The K.K.C. College of Education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) is a 2 years course that is offered at the UG level. The total tuition of the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) is INR 42,400. Other than this, students might also be required to pay additional one-time admission and registration fee to confirm their admission. The total seats available for admission to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) are 100. Know more about K.K.C. College of Education B.Ed:

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) at K.K.C. College of Education Highlights
- As per the Right to Education (RTE) Act, to get appointed as a teacher in any school in India, a candidate must pass the Teacher Eligiblity Test (TET)/ Central Teacher Eligibility Test (CTET) exam, conducted by the appropriate Government according to the guidelines framed by NCTE.

The best choice depends on your career aspirations:
· If you want to become a teacher: Opt for a B.Ed. It's the mandatory qualification for teaching in most schools.
· If you want to pursue a career in research or a science-related field: A BSc would be more suitable. It provides a strong foundation for further studies and specialised careers.
· If you're unsure: Consider your interests and skills. Do you enjoy teaching and interacting with students? Or are you more drawn to scientific exploration and research?
Additional options:
· M.Ed.: If you already have a B.Ed., you can pursue a Master of Education for career advancement or specialisation in a particular teaching area.
· Diploma courses: Various specialised Diploma courses in education or related fields can enhance your skills and knowledge.
B.Ed is usually of two years duration. However, some universities and colleges also offer one-year B.Ed courses to students. It consists of four semesters, wherein the final semester is usually reserved for training and practical experience in teaching in any school. The course prepares individuals to be well-trained teachers who can handle children of any age.
